The goal of this class is a sitcom spec script of a currently running show, whether single-camera, four-camera, single-camera (cable) or animated--suitable for submission to literary agents, network executives and/or TV executive producers; and to that end the student has complete access to all that The Comedy Lab and The iO West have to offer, including a live staged reading of the student's completed script during one of The Comedy Lab Live performances on any given Sunday evening. Here's how it shakes out week-to-week: the student choses a show and creates six pitches (1st week); a single pitch is chosen and then partially outlined (2nd week); a detailed, scene-by-scene outline is completed (3rd week); special focus on the cold opening, the act break and the tag (4th week); completion of first half (5th week); completion of second half (6th week); brutal rewrites (7th week); and, developing a business plan (8th week); all of which starts with the opportunity for the student to stage a reading of his or her spec and solicit audience reactions during the before mentioned Comedy Lab Live!
